End of Cooking Cycle: When your food has finished cooking, many microwaves will beep to let you know that it’s done. To stop the beeping, open the door to your microwave or press the “stop” button.
Error Message: If there is an error message displayed on your microwave, it may beep to alert you to the problem. Check your user manual for troubleshooting tips or contact customer support for assistance.
Low Battery: Some microwaves use batteries to power their display and control panel. If the battery is low, your microwave may beep intermittently. Replace the battery to stop the beeping.
Metal Objects: Never put metal objects inside a microwave as they can cause sparks and potentially start a fire.
Electrical Problems: Faulty wiring or components in the microwave can also cause it to catch on fire. If you suspect an electrical issue, unplug the appliance immediately and do not use it until it has been inspected by a professional.
Food Debris: If food debris accumulates inside the microwave, it can ignite during cooking and start a fire. Clean your microwave regularly to prevent this from happening.
Defective Microwave: In rare cases, a defective microwave may have design flaws that make it more prone to catching on fire. Check with the manufacturer for any recalls or safety warnings related to your specific model.
Wipe down the inside: Using a damp sponge or cloth, wipe down the interior of the microwave, paying special attention to any areas with heavy food splatters. If there are stubborn stains, you can use a mild dish soap and warm water.
Clean the turntable: Remove the turntable from your microwave and wash it in warm soapy water, or place it in your dishwasher if it’s dishwasher safe.
Clean the exterior: Wipe down the exterior of your microwave with a damp cloth or sponge, again using a mild dish soap if necessary.
Deodorize: To remove any unpleasant odors from your microwave, place a bowl of water with lemon slices or vinegar inside and heat on high for several minutes. This will help break up any stuck-on food and neutralize smells
Dry everything thoroughly: Use a clean towel or paper towels to dry all surfaces of your microwave before using it again.
